THEM is an all-girl pop-rock band from Seattle. The name THEM is an acronym of the members’ names: Thompson, Hudson, Ellie, and Maia. The group made their debut on June 4, 2021, with the single “BAD 4 U”. Their most popular song, “Sunset Blvd”, was released on July 8, 2022, and is featured on their debut EP the car ep, released July 22, 2022.
Since their debut, THEM has been consistently releasing music and performing at major Seattle venues and festivals, including The Paramount Theatre, Bumbershoot Music Festival, and even atop the Space Needle. Their second EP, Girls Mind, dropped on June 28, 2024, and their latest single, “Cool Girl”, was released on December 12, 2025.

J.Y.N. (Just Your Name) is a Korean-American singer-songwriter, producer, and multi-instrumentalist based in Chicago, United States. His sound blends alternative rock with elements of bedroom pop, blues, and punk rock. He made his debut on January 23, 2021, with the single “Hard to Love Reflections,” which remains his most popular track with over 2.4 million streams.
J.Y.N. released his debut EP, For Fuchsia, on September 2, 2022, and has consistently released singles since. He released his second EP, Bittersweet, on November 17, 2023, followed by his latest EP, Clip Distortion, which dropped on December 19, 2025.
In August 2025, he opened for wave to earth and is set to join Sylo and hevel at Tomorrow Never Knows (TNK) Fest in Chicago on January 22. Chelsea Cara is a singer-songwriter from Singapore. Her music spans multiple genres, including pop, EDM, synth-wave, dance pop, and dark pop. On February 28, 2020, she was featured on the single “Live On” alongside Foxela and Brittle Bear. In May, she collaborated with Foxela again for “wanted you so bad”, and she released numerous collaborations throughout 2020 and 2021. Chelsea made her official solo debut on July 28, 2022, with the single “Walls”.
Since her solo debut, Chelsea has consistently released music, leading up to her debut EP PHASES, released on March 14, 2025. She kicked off 2026 strong with the January 2 single “landline,” which is such a bop.

Avi Roy is an R&B/Soul artist from Toronto, Canada. He made his debut on August 4, 2021, with the single “Yourself,” followed by his first album, the london tapes, released on February 11, 2022.
We discovered Avi Roy in 2023 after the release of his single “Healing” on April 7, 2023. Since his debut, he has consistently released music, including the EP MY WAYS, which dropped on June 28, 2024.
In 2025, Avi released two more EPs: as you run away on January 22, and LOST IN ABYSS 1, which closed out the year on December 31.
Avi is set to kick off 2026 with a new single, “who am i?,” releasing on January 16.

ROM COM is a Nashville-based indie rock/synth-pop duo formed by Aron Rosing and Tyler Murray. Known for their nostalgic aesthetic and sound, the duo draws inspiration from classic films like Ferris Bueller’s Day Off and The Breakfast Club.
They made their debut on October 20, 2023, with the single “Tom Cruisin’,” and have since consistently released EPs and singles, building their distinctive retro-leaning discography.
In 2025, ROM COM released two albums: *Never Know* in May and End Zone in August. Later that year, they followed up with “Don’t Think Twice,” released on October 20, 2025. This was the track that first introduced us to their music as they were promoting it on TikTok. They closed out the year with “McConaughey,” a collaboration with Wolf Mahler, released on November 24.

Leanys is a Cuban artist raised in Miami, blending elements of Latin, R&B, alternative, and pop, and singing in both Spanish and English. She made her debut on March 19, 2021, with the single “soaking”.
Since her debut, Leanys has released many singles, leading up to her debut album, Nova, released on August 9, 2024. The track “Explicame” on this album was what first introduced us to her music.
On May 30, 2025, Leanys released her sophomore album, El Arte Del Cambio. Following the album’s release, she continued to put out new music, closing out the year with the single “Aquí Aquí,” released on November 14, 2025.

Ben Ellis is a Welsh singer-songwriter who first gained popularity on TikTok, where his acoustic covers earned him a following of over 140K. He made his official debut on March 9, 2022, with the single “not this time.” Following that, he released his debut EP, The Ed’s House, on November 15, 2023.
We discovered Ben in 2025 after hearing his single “Does It Get Cold In California,” released on October 16, 2024, which caught our attention after coming on shuffe following Bradley Simpson’s album on Spotify. This track was later included on his sophomore EP, The Hollywood EP, released on February 21, 2025.
Ben has released singles every few months since his debut and he ended 2025 off strong with the release of “still be friends” on November 12.
Looking ahead to 2026, Ben is set to perform at Victorious Festival in Portsmouth, UK, in August, further solidifying his growing presence in the indie-pop scene.

igloobay is a South Korean rock/pop-rock band consisting of Joymin (vocals/guitar), Hyeong Seok (drums), and Kookoo (bass). The group made their debut on July 29, 2015, with the double-single EP Walk Off, featuring “Winding Road” and “The World of Toys”.
Since their debut, igloobay has released a number of singles along with two full-length albums: 100-8 on March 15, 2017, and Four season’s Seoul, released on November 30, 2022. On November 23, 2024, they released the EP Not Neverland , featuring the track “Peter,pan,” which is how we discovered the band in February 2025.
Their most recent releases, “Garden” and “That Child” were released on November 28, 2025.

can’t be blue (캔트비블루) is a South Korean alt-rock band consisting of four members: Lee Dohun (vocals), Kwon Dahyun (keyboards), Lee Hwiwon (bass), and Kim Chaehyun (guitar). They debuted on June 20, 2024, with the single “사랑이라 했던 말 속에서” (Within the Words I Once Called Love). Following their debut, the band released their first EP, Blue Vinyl, on August 30, 2024.
The group has continued to release music frequently, and we discovered them in June 2025 through their single “First Sight,” released on June 24. They closed out the year with “dim,” released on December 5.
We love a rock band, and can’t be blue delivers with a distinctive style and sound. Their more recent releases lean toward a softer, ballad-like direction, showcasing another side of their artistry

francene rouelle is a Texas-based Filipina-American singer-songwriter signed to mHart, Austin’s first and only Asian American independent music label. She made her debut on January 19, 2024, with the single “love wasn’t enough”.
On April 19, 2024, francene released her debut album, finally a fairytale, which is how we discovered her, followed by a deluxe edition in July 2024. Throughout 2025, she released several singles leading up to her sophomore album, off the carousel, which dropped on August 1.
She closed out the year with the double-single EP songs i like to sing, released on November 14, 2025, featuring “B.O.A.T.” and “wyd now.”

Lisa Heller is an alternative indie-pop singer-songwriter from a small town in Connecticut. She made her debut on June 24, 2016, with the single “hope.” Since then, Lisa has remained highly active, releasing a steady stream of singles and EPs.
We discovered her in early 2025 following the release of her single “people pleaser,” which released on January 24. On April 3, 2025, she released her EP HELLO, MY NAME IS, and later closed out the year with “Swinging for the Fence,” released on December 3, 2025.

Rohin is an alternative/indie singer-songwriter based in Toronto and signed to Universal Music Canada. He made his debut on September 25, 2024, with the EP so follow me down.
We discovered Rohin shortly after the release of his sophomore EP, As The Light Fades, which released on August 29, 2025 and showcases his introspective songwriting and atmospheric sound.
Later that fall, Rohin opened for Sunday (1994) on September 23, 2025, marking another key moment in his musical journey. With a some strong releases so far, Rohin is quickly establishing himself as an artist to watch.

Sean, also known by his artist name vylarem, is a Canadian indie-pop/alt-pop singer-songwriter who made his debut on June 2, 2025, with the single “write a note.”
Following his debut, vylarem continued to release new music throughout 2025, including “tell you” and “could he” in September, “more than this” in November, and “what we’d do,” released on December 30 to close out the year.
